Data Structures and Algorithms courses can help you learn about arrays, linked lists, trees, and graph structures, along with sorting and searching algorithms. You can build skills in problem-solving, optimizing code efficiency, and analyzing algorithm complexity. Many courses introduce tools like Python, Java, or C++ for implementing these concepts, as well as platforms for coding challenges that reinforce your understanding through practical application.

University of Leeds
Skills you'll gain: Resource Allocation, Operations Research, Production Planning, Graph Theory, Data-Driven Decision-Making, Decision Making, Mathematical Modeling, Process Optimization, Network Planning And Design, Complex Problem Solving, Computational Logic, Algorithms, Linear Algebra, Cryptography
Beginner · Course · 1 - 4 Weeks
Multiple educators
Beginner · Specialization

Multiple educators
Skills you'll gain: Retrieval-Augmented Generation, AI Product Strategy, Independent Thinking, Productivity Software, Generative AI, AI Personalization, Artificial Intelligence and Machine Learning (AI/ML), Responsible AI, Business Communication, Emotional Intelligence, Productivity, Operational Efficiency, Administration, Business Operations, Planning, Project Planning, Business Planning, Project Management, Business Administration, Business
Beginner · Specialization · 1 - 3 Months

Pontificia Universidad Católica de Chile
Skills you'll gain: Organizational Change, Organizational Structure, Change Management, Business Strategy, Organizational Effectiveness, Strategic Decision-Making, Organizational Leadership, Innovation, Knowledge Transfer, Emerging Technologies, Influencing, Persona (User Experience)
Mixed · Course · 1 - 3 Months

Skillshare
Skills you'll gain: Cinematography, Photography, Video Editing, Videography, Post-Production, Color Theory, Image Quality
Intermediate · Course · 1 - 4 Weeks

Amazon Web Services
Skills you'll gain: Kubernetes, Amazon Web Services, Scalability, Containerization, Cloud Management, Cloud Computing Architecture, Cloud Deployment, Managed Services, Software Versioning
Beginner · Course · 1 - 4 Weeks
Starweaver
Skills you'll gain: Cyber Governance, Cyber Security Strategy, Cybersecurity, Strategic Leadership, Cyber Risk, Strategic Communication, Safety Culture, Stakeholder Communications, Business Leadership, Security Management, Governance, IT Management, Communication Strategies, Computer Security Awareness Training, Security Awareness, Culture Transformation, Performance Metric, Communication, Business Metrics, Employee Training
Advanced · Course · 1 - 3 Months

Skills you'll gain: Google App Engine, Cloud Applications, Restful API, Google Cloud Platform, Cloud Computing Architecture, OAuth, Cloud Computing, Cloud Services, Application Deployment, Platform As A Service (PaaS), Python Programming, Cloud Storage, Application Performance Management, Authentications, Web Applications, Data Store, MySQL, Scalability
Beginner · Course · 1 - 3 Months

Skills you'll gain: Partnership Accounting, Liquidation, Capital Expenditure, Reconciliation, Ledgers (Accounting), Accounting, Business Valuation, Balance Sheet, Regulation and Legal Compliance
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Continuous Monitoring, Security Controls, Cybersecurity, Risk Management Framework, Cyber Risk, NIST 800-53, Risk Management, Cloud Security, Cyber Security Assessment, Incident Response, Authorization (Computing), Vulnerability Assessments, Disaster Recovery
Beginner · Course · 1 - 3 Months

Skills you'll gain: Brand Strategy, Storytelling, Branding, Prompt Engineering, ChatGPT, Brand Awareness, Cross-Channel Marketing, Content Creation, AI Personalization, Consumer Behaviour, Email Marketing
Intermediate · Course · 1 - 4 Weeks

DeepLearning.AI
Skills you'll gain: Large Language Modeling, Prompt Engineering, Retrieval-Augmented Generation, Transfer Learning, Data Preprocessing
Intermediate · Project · Less Than 2 Hours